An important update
The closure of the Regional Tech Hub is a significant loss for rural, regional and remote consumers, who will no longer have access to a dedicated, independent telecommunications support service.
Over recent years, a significant amount of BIRRR’s consumer information was transferred to, or replaced by links to, Regional Tech Hub resources. With the Regional Tech Hub website closing at the end of August 2026, some links on the BIRRR website may no longer work and some information may need to be reviewed or updated.
BIRRR is a volunteer organisation and cannot replace the Regional Tech Hub or the consumer support service it provided. We will continue our existing work providing independent information and advocacy for rural, regional and remote telecommunications, within the capacity of our volunteers.
It will take some time for us to review the BIRRR website and ensure our information reflects recent changes. We appreciate your patience during this transition.
